How much do hospital linen services j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 4, 2026, the average hourly pay for hospital linen services in the United States is $15.28,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$12.98 and $16.35 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Hospital Linen Services position, and why are they important?

To thrive in Hospital Linen Services, you need attention to detail, organizational skills, and basic knowledge of infection control, typically gained through on-the-job training or prior custodial/housekeeping experience. Familiarity with commercial laundry equipment, inventory management systems, and safety protocols is often required. Strong teamwork, time management, and reliability help individuals excel in this role. These competencies ensure that hospital linens are properly cleaned, tracked, and supplied, helping maintain sanitary conditions and smooth facility operations.

What are the typical daily tasks for someone working in Hospital Linen Services?

Hospital Linen Services staff are responsible for collecting soiled linens, operating industrial laundry machines, sorting and folding clean items, and distributing fresh linens throughout the hospital. The role may involve restocking storage rooms, monitoring inventory levels, and adhering to strict hygiene and safety protocols. Staff often work as part of a team and coordinate with departments like nursing and housekeeping to ensure timely delivery and availability of linens. This work is essential for maintaining a clean, efficient, and safe environment for both patients and healthcare professionals.

What is a Hospital Linen Services job?

A Hospital Linen Services job involves managing, cleaning, and distributing linens such as sheets, gowns, and towels in a healthcare facility. Workers ensure that all linens are properly sanitized to meet hygiene and safety standards. Duties may include sorting, washing, drying, folding, and delivering linens to various hospital departments. Attention to detail and adherence to infection control protocols are essential in this role.

NOVO Health Services is seeking a reliable and detail-oriented Part-Time Linen Distribution Technician to support daily linen operations at Robert Packer Hospital. This role is responsible for ensuring the timely delivery, collection, and stocking of hospital linen to support patient care.

This is a hands-on, non-supervisory role focused on maintaining inventory levels, supporting clinical staff, and ensuring uninterrupted linen service throughout the facility.

Schedule & Work Hours
  • Part-Time Position: Approximately up to 30 hours per week
  • Primary Schedule: Monday through Friday
  • Shift Type: Day Shift Only (No evenings or overnight hours)
  • Start Time: Typically 5:00 AM, with flexibility of approximately 1 hour depending on operational needs

Additional Expectations:

  • Occasional support for weekday or weekend call-offs (rare)
  • Ability to assist with coverage during planned employee vacations
Key Responsibilities
  • Deliver clean linen to designated hospital departments according to established PAR levels
  • Collect and transport soiled linen safely and in compliance with infection control standards
  • Stock linen carts, shelves, and storage areas
  • Monitor and maintain accurate linen inventory levels
  • Respond promptly to linen requests from hospital staff
  • Maintain cleanliness and organization of linen room and supply areas
  • Follow all hospital safety, infection control, and NOVO operational policies
QualificationsRequired:
  • High School Diploma or GED
  • Strong reliability and attendance
  • Ability to work independently in a fast-paced healthcare environment
  • Good communication and customer service skills
  • Ability to lift up to 35 pounds and push/pull carts up to 250 pounds
Preferred:
  • Prior experience in hospital linen services, environmental services, warehouse, or logistics
  • Familiarity with inventory management or PAR level systems
  • Experience working in a healthcare setting
Work Environment
  • Hospital setting supporting patient care operations
  • Active role requiring walking, lifting, and cart movement throughout the facility
  • Early morning shift environment with consistent weekday scheduling
